19:44B-6. Willful and knowledgeable failure to file or filing false statement; penalty a. A candidate who willfully and knowingly fails or refuses to file a financial disclosure statement on a date prior to the election for which he has filed a declaration of candidacy or a petition to appear on the ballot shall be guilty of a crime of the fourth degree. b. A candidate who willfully and knowingly files any financial disclosure statement which is false, inaccurate or incomplete in any substantial and material manner or particular, shall be guilty of a crime of the fourth degree.
